Tree Service services encompass a range of professional solutions aimed at maintaining, removing, or improving the health and safety of trees on residential, commercial, and public properties. These services typically include pruning, trimming, crown reduction, and shaping to promote healthy growth and enhance aesthetic appeal. Tree removal is also a common component, especially when trees pose safety hazards, are diseased, or have become structurally compromised. Additionally, stump grinding and removal may be offered to eliminate unsightly or hazardous stumps after trees are taken down. These services are performed using spec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the work is conducted safely and efficiently.

One of the primary issues addressed by tree service providers is the mitigation of hazards caused by overgrown or damaged trees. Unhealthy or unstable trees can pose risks to property, pedestrians, and vehicles, especially during storms or high winds. Overgrown branches may interfere with power lines or obstruct visibility, creating safety concerns. Tree services also help prevent property damage by removing dead or decaying limbs that could fall unexpectedly. In cases of disease or pest infestation, pruning and treatment can help restore the health of affected trees or prevent the spread to neighboring greenery.

The overview below groups typical Tree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jefferson County,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Tree Trimming - The cost for trimming trees typically ranges from $200 to $800 depending on the size and number of trees. Smaller trees may cost around $150, while larger, mature trees can reach $1,000 or more.

Tree Removal - Removing a single tree usually costs between $300 and $2,500, with factors like tree height and location influencing the price. Less complex removals t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um.

Stump Grinding - Stump grinding services often fall within the $100 to $400 range per stump, depending on size and accessibility. Larger or multiple stumps may increase the overall cost.

Emergency Tree Services - Emergency or storm-related tree services can vary widely, typically costing between $500 and $3,000 based on the scope of work needed. Urgent jobs tend to be more expensive due to immediate response requ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
